The Scarcity of Kindergartens in Some Regions
In some regions, access to high-quality kindergartens can be scarce. This is a problem because early education plays a crucial role in a child's development. In areas where kindergartens are in short supply, parents may have to resort to subpar alternatives, such as overcrowded daycare centers or inexperienced home daycare providers. As a result, some children may miss out on the early learning experiences that are crucial for their success later in life.
The Importance of High-Quality Early Education
High-quality early education has been shown to have numerous benefits for children. Studies have found that children who attend high-quality preschool programs are more likely to graduate from high school and attend college. They also tend to have better social skills, stronger language development, and higher cognitive skills than children who don't attend preschool. Additionally, high-quality preschool programs have been linked to higher earnings later in life and decreased likelihood of involvement in criminal activity.
